Symptom:
*HOOD AJAR CIRCUIT OPEN
POSSIBLE CAUSES
HOOD AJAR SWITCH GROUND CIRCUIT OPEN
INTERMITTENT CONDITION
HOOD AJAR SWITCH
HOOD AJAR SWITCH SENSE CIRCUIT OPEN
BODY CONTROL MODULE - HOOD AJAR CIRCUIT OPEN
TEST ACTION APPLICABILITY
1 Open the Hood.
With the DRBIIIt in Inputs/Outputs, read the HOOD AJAR SW state.
Does the DRBIIIt display CLOSED?
All
Yes The condition that caused this symptom is currently not present.
Inspect the related wiring harness for a possible intermittent
condition. Look for any partially open connectors or broken wires.
Perform BODY VERIFICATION TEST - VER 1.
No Go To 2
2 Disconnect the Hood Ajar switch connector.
Using a 12-volt Test Light connected to 12-volts, test the Ground circuit for
continuity.
Does the light illuminate?
All
Yes Go To 3
No Repair the Ground circuit for an open.
Perform BODY VERIFICATION TEST - VER 1.
3 Disconnect the Hood Ajar Switch connector.
With the DRBIIIt in Inputs/Outputs, read the HOOD AJAR SW state.
Connect a jumper wire between Sense circuit and the Ground circuit.
Does the DRBIIIt display HOOD AJAR SW: CLOSED?
All
Yes Replace the Hood Ajar Switch.
Perform BODY VERIFICATION TEST - VER 1.
No Go To 4
4 Disconnect the Body Control Module C4 harness connector.
Disconnect the Hood Ajar Switch harness connector.
Measure the resistance of the Sense circuit.
Is the resistance below 5.0 ohms?
All
Yes Go To 5
No Repair the Hood Ajar Switch Sense circuit for an open.
Perform BODY VERIFICATION TEST - VER 1.
5 If there are no possible causes remaining, view repair. All
Repair
Replace the Body Control Module.
Perform BODY VERIFICATION TEST - VER 1.
